Cricket Infestation: Signs, Causes, and Prevention

Dealing with a pest problem can be annoying . Identifying the initial signs is essential. Look for distinctive chirping particularly at night , nibbled leaves, and tiny brown critters – often found around the perimeter . Several reasons contribute to cricket infestations , including excessive humidity, overgrown plants , and cluttered areas . Avoiding problems involve improving drainage , mowing grass, patching holes in your home's foundation , and keeping things tidy . You might also consider safe deterrents or calling an exterminator if the issue persists.

Tips for Getting Rid of House Crickets : Proven Bug Management

Dealing with noisy house crickets can be irritating . Thankfully, several techniques work for controlling these pests. First, carefully inspect your home's foundation, windows, and doors for cracks – seal them with caulk . Next , eliminate moisture levels by fixing any drips and using a dehumidifier . Keep your surroundings clean , as clutter can attract crickets. Think about setting sticky traps to trap crickets. If all else fails, you could consider bug spray specifically for crickets, adhering to product directions precisely . Proactive measures is vital for avoiding future infestations.
